Japan's JPYC and SBI Boost Stablecoin Payment and Lending Services
JPYC Co. announced a capital‑and‑business partnership with logistics firm AZ‑COM Maruwa on July 22. The collaboration will create a JPYC‑based payment platform for Maruwa’s network of roughly 2,300 partner companies, drivers, employees and other stakeholders. AZ‑COM Maruwa will acquire a 2.9% stake in JPYC, develop a dedicated wallet app and integrate smart‑contract‑linked payment automation to lower bank‑transfer fees and speed settlement for small logistics operators.
Separately, SBI VC Trade launched Japan’s first trust‑type yen‑denominated stablecoin lending service, JPYSC Lending, on July 16. The service offers a 12‑week term with an introductory 3% annual interest rate, higher than typical bank deposits, and is available through the VCTRADE platform. Users can lend JPYSC and earn fees, supporting broader adoption of stablecoins for asset formation in Japan.
